Output 58d6f77758e85a16fb981d22cb45f7da2c5cbafb2a99cba231a39016de89c436:0

value
686166
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0387da2b2f00796d5bedb6aa1000f9fd30241d2f OP_EQUALVERIFY OP_CHECKSIG
address
1KfmkhA1R851zeprvJteTEQnVHhpfRWsa
transaction
58d6f77758e85a16fb981d22cb45f7da2c5cbafb2a99cba231a39016de89c436
confirmations
415932
spent
true